Pros

Contract position was good, pay was good.

Cons

The recruiters relentlessly pursued me up until I started the contract. Then they became difficult to reach. It took me reaching out multiple times to get paid - I wasn't paid for 4-6 weeks after I started the role. The actual job logistics were unclear (travel, timesheets, etc.) and handled by the company I worked with instead of Enzo. I was "guaranteed" a contract-to-hire multiple times, in writing and over the phone, only to find out the company won't hire full-time months down the line. This is a significant amount of income lost via PTO, insurance, and salary. Told "don't worry about it, we will handle it" by the recruiters when I expressed concerns with pay or otherwise, only to hear nothing back for weeks. The contracted job itself has been good - the company ultimately have solved most of the problems dilligently, without help from Enzo Tech. If you are a contractor considering a role via Enzo Tech, I highly caution you. If they make promises about the job, take these with a grain of salt. Their job is to get you hired so they can be paid, but after that you are unimportant. They treated me largely as a nuisance when I ask for clarity or assistance after getting hired.
